The short version

Delft Colony is a city of 412 people in California. This skews young, with a median age of 25.5. The poverty rate is 69.2%, above the 12.8% national rate. 5% of adults hold a bachelor's degree, below the 33% national rate. There are 303 fewer people here than in 2019. 98% were living in the same home a year earlier.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Delft Colony, California?

Delft Colony, California has about 412 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.

Is Delft Colony, California expensive?

In Delft Colony, California, the typical rent is about $897 a month.

How educated are people in Delft Colony, California?

About 4.8% of adults age 25 and over in Delft Colony, California h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Delft Colony, California?

About 69.2% of people in Delft Colony, California live below the federal poverty line.
